Why is calling upon the name of the Lord important for Christians?

Answered in 2 sources

Calling upon the name of the Lord is vital as it signifies our recognition of Him as Savior and our dependence on His grace.

For Christians, calling upon the name of the Lord is not merely an act of verbal acknowledgment; it is an expression of faith rooted in a transformed heart. The act symbolizes a recognition of one's need for salvation and reliance on God's gracious provision through Christ. As highlighted in Romans, this calling is the manifestation of a new heart created by the Spirit, enabling the believer to affirm their trust in God's character and promises. It is crucial for the believer's faith journey as it reflects their relationship with Christ and understanding of His redemptive work, where acknowledging His name signifies claiming all He has done for us.
Scripture References: Romans 10:13-14, 2 Timothy 1:9, Romans 10:13
